3 Reasons Successful Coaches use Engaging Visual Resources
1) They improve quality and focus of coaching conversations
While verbal and written coaching techniques alone are beneficial, the average person actually processes visuals 60,000 times faster than text! This means that not only are concepts understood more efficiently when visual resources are used, but more time is made available to dive deeper into the material! The use of visual resources also makes it easier to highlight key points, making them easier to store in long-term memory.
2) They serve as a takeaway from conversations
Coaches provide inspiration and guidance to those they lead, but obviously, they aren’t available during all hours of the day. It’s important for the individuals being coached to have something to look back on when coaches are busy and they’re in need of a reminder of the topics discussed. This keeps those being coached focused on the job at hand and prevents confusion post conversation.
3) They create a more engaging experience
In order for individuals being coached to actively learn the concepts being introduced to them, they need to be engaged. This is why visual aids have been found to improve learning by up to 400 percent! When the learner feels interested and drawn to the material, they will retain more of it.
